National Learning Assessment begins nationwide
The Federal Ministry of Education declared this week as National Learning Assessment Week. Pupils in Primary Three, Primary Five, Junior Secondary Two and Senior Secondary Two will be tested in English, Mathematics, Basic Science and Citizenship.

HACEY launches maternal health outreach across six states
Project Agbebi will train health workers and support pregnant mothers in Kaduna, Ogun, Anambra, Cross River, Taraba and Kwara. The project targets safe delivery kits and community support groups.

Congo files case against Rwanda at ICJ
The Democratic Republic of Congo accused Rwanda of supporting armed groups in the east and violating international conventions, seeking reparations at the International Court of Justice.
Burkina Faso severs diplomatic ties with France
Burkina Faso broke relations with its former colonial ruler, citing security and sovereignty concerns. France said it is considering reciprocal measures.
